QUESTIONS & ANSWERS - before you visit malaysia

Climate?
The climate of Malaysia is hot and humid throughout the year, the highest SPF Sun block is recommended, Temperature ranging from 21°C (70°F) to about 35°C (95°F). Occasional rain during the period between Oct~Feb helps to bring down the temperature & usually last than an hour. Humidity between 75% and 100%!

Clothing?
Light clothing is recommended, golf cap, sunglasses & umbrella will reduce the heat of the day.

Menu for the day
Cleaning - hosing down with water , deep cleaning with Optimum Power clean, safe for clear coat.
Claying –2 ounces of ONR optimum no rinse wash with 500ml water, as lube
ONR wash again with 1 microfibes towel – dry by 2 cloths,

Glass cleaning – heavy water marks stain on all Glass polish (with rotary spread with speed 1 on single side wool & continue to polish gradually speed progression & eventually finish at speed 6 Makita)

Paint defects/overspray corrections – Megs M105 with Lake country CCS cutting pad (with rotary spread with speed 1 & moving to speed 3-4)

Polishing with Megs 205 (with Lake country CCS cutting pad (with rotary spread with speed 1 & moving to speed 3-2)

Protectant - Opti seal – sealed the whole car, including paint, plastic & rubber trims –
NXT 2.0 ( as the owner choice) - Uqd
